Nyack, NY – October 26, 2009 – At their Annual Harvest Home gathering, The Nyack Hospital Auxiliary presented the Hospital with a check for $40,000, representing funds raised between June and October, 2009.  This donation was raised through the tireless efforts of the Auxilians, who generate funds through the Gift Shop, Thrift Shop, Cafeteria Sales, Membership dues, and other events held throughout the year.  The Auxiliary has raised over $80,000 to benefit Nyack Hospital to date in 2009.

 

Caption: ( left to right) Mindy Rader, Auxiliary Coordinator; Elaine Weiss, Vice President, Nyack Hospital Auxiliary; Bridget Simon, President, Nyack Hospital Auxiliary; David Freed, DHA, President & CEO, Nyack Hospital; Phyllis Darrin, Thrift Shop Coordinator

 

The Auxiliary is made up of volunteers who are dedicated to raising funds to support Nyack Hospital programs and services. They run and manage the very busy Gift Shop located in the main lobby of the hospital and Thrift Shop on Main Street in Nyack. They are also very involved in the planning and executing of some of the hospital’s biggest fundraising events during the year, including the Holiday House sale and Mother’s Day Plant Sale.

Nyack Hospital

 

Nyack Hospital is a 375-bed community acute care medical and surgical hospital located in Rockland County, NY.  Founded in 1895, it is a member of the NewYork-Presbyterian Healthcare System. For additional information, please visit our web site at www.nyackhospital.org.
